Metabolome and Transcriptome Profiling Unveil the Mechanisms of Polyphenol Synthesis in the Developing Endopleura of Walnut (Juglans regia L.)

Abstract: Walnut (Juglans regia L.) is an important woody nut tree species, and its endopleura (the inner coating of a seed) is rich in many polyphenols. Thus far, the pathways and essential genes involved in polyphenol biosynthesis in developing walnut endopleura remain largely unclear. We compared metabolite differences between endopleura and embryo in mature walnuts, and analyzed the changes of metabolites in endopleura at 35, 63, 91, 119, and 147 days after pollination (DAP). “…In the grape berry pericarp, UGT88A1 is a key structural gene that is negatively correlated with some flavonoids. The PAL , C4H , 4CL , CHS , CHI , F3H , LDOX , and ANR were highly expressed in the maturity development stage in yellow walnut endopleura [ 33 ]. Most of the CHS (Jr01G10656, Jr02G10304), F3’H (Jr07G12902) and C4H (Jr13G11700) genes involved in polyphenol synthesis are highly expressed during the walnut ripening stage(p5).…”

“…Although the walnut endopleura has a weaker physical protective barrier function compared to the outer shell, it undeniably has a strong chemical defensive function that protects the walnut kernel. This protective function mainly arises from a high concentration of diverse phytochemicals [ 20 , 33 ]. Walnuts contain a significant amount of lipoprotein-bound antioxidants.…”
